Walesby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'of Walesby': (1) a parish near Market Rasen, Lincolnshire; (2) a parish near Ollerton, Nottinghamshire.
Osbert de Walesby, Lincolnshire, 1273. Hundred Rolls.
William de Walesby, Nottinghamshire, ibid.
1764. Married — Edward Mortimer and Ann Walesby: St. George, Hanover Square.
1793. — Edward Walsby, D.D., and Henrietta Bisset: ibid.
1815. Buried — Edward Walsby, D.D.: Canterbury Cath.
(English + Scandinavian) belonging to Walesby (Lincs, Notts: 13th cent. Walesby, Domesday Walesbi) = Wale’s Place [v. Wale, and + Old Norse bý-r, farmstead, &c.]
A parish in Nottinghamshire, in which county the family resided, temp. Edward I.
A location name in Lincolnshire, Nottinghamshire.

How Common Is The Last Name Walesby? popularity and diffusion
The last name Walesby is the 1,428,594th most frequent surname on a global scale, borne by approximately 1 in 48,261,893 people. The last name Walesby is predominantly found in The Americas, where 50 percent of Walesby reside; 49 percent reside in North America and 49 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most common in The United States, where it is carried by 72 people, or 1 in 5,034,152. In The United States Walesby is most common in: Florida, where 26 percent are found, Washington, where 26 percent are found and Maryland, where 19 percent are found. Aside from The United States it exists in 6 countries. It also occurs in England, where 23 percent are found and New Zealand, where 16 percent are found.
Walesby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Walesby has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Walesby surname rose 7,200 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it contracted 17 percent between 1881 and 2014.
